Daftar Isi:

Driver Mouse Atari 800: 3 Langkah
Driver Mouse Atari 800: 3 Langkah

Video: Driver Mouse Atari 800: 3 Langkah

Video: Driver Mouse Atari 800: 3 Langkah
Video: Bobterm on Atari 800 to Linux computer 2024, November
Anonim
Driver Mouse Atari 800
Driver Mouse Atari 800

Ringkasan

Instruksi ini menjelaskan cara menambahkan mouse gaya Windows ke Atari 800.

pengantar

Apakah Anda memiliki cakar, bukan angka yang berlawanan? Apakah Anda menemukan menekan tombol panah untuk memindahkan kursor di sekitar layar kerja keras? Apakah Anda ingin pindah ke abad ke-21? Bobbs mungkin punya jawabannya.

Perlengkapan

Komputer Atari 8 bit

Beberapa cara menyimpan kode, seperti drive disk Atari (apakah ini masih ada?), atau SIO2BT, atau SIO2SD

Editor Perakitan Atari

Joystik

Lihat

www.instructables.com/id/Atari-8-Bit-Optic…

untuk opsi 3 daftar bagian

Langkah 1: Opsi 1 - Teknologi Rendah

Opsi 1 - Teknologi Rendah
Opsi 1 - Teknologi Rendah

Pertama, ini dari Buku Ketiga Compute of Atari. Ini menggunakan rutinitas VBlank untuk memindahkan kursor di sekitar layar dengan joystick.

www.atariarchives.org/c3ba/page163.php

Tentu saja layak disebut. Kodenya bagus dan ringkas, berfungsi dan tidak memakan banyak memori seperti opsi 2. Namun, saya rasa kita bisa melakukan yang lebih baik.

Langkah 2: Opsi 2 - Driver Mouse

Opsi 2 - Pengemudi Mouse
Opsi 2 - Pengemudi Mouse

Mengikuti langkah 1, biarkan joystick tetap terpasang dan lihat tiga file terlampir. File ATR untuk mereka yang memiliki teknologi, dan file teks dari kode sumber - semuanya dalam kode perakitan 6502.

Driver mouse ada dalam dua bagian;

1) File autorun.sys yang melakukan booting saat dihidupkan, mengatur PMG dan mengimpor rutin VBlank. Kode sumber ada di file mouseloader2.txt. Saya rasa mungkin ada ruang untuk perbaikan dalam menangani.

2) Rutinitas VBlank (M. BIN) yang menangani gerakan dan klik tombol.

Ada beberapa faktor pembatas.

Joystick Atari adalah yang pertama karena hanya memiliki gerakan dan tombol api, jadi tidak seperti mouse modern, kami tidak dapat memiliki terlalu banyak trik

Kedua, file autorun.sys berada di halaman 6 jadi kami dibatasi hingga 256 byte. Ini sebenarnya bukan masalah karena berfungsi dan dapat dihapus setelah memuat.

Pengemudi tidak bisa terlalu lama karena berjalan di VBlank, dan harus selesai dengan cepat atau hal buruk akan terjadi.

Lebih dari 2k digunakan, bersama dengan pemutar PMG 0 dan rutinitas VBlank.

Setelah semua ini, tinggal kita atas, bawah, kiri, kanan, dan klik / tembak untuk memindahkan kursor teks ke posisi baru. Masih lebih baik daripada menggunakan tombol panah sekalipun.

Menekan System Reset membunuh mouse dan mengubah mode grafis menyebabkan hal-hal buruk terjadi. Tetap terbaik untuk mengedit teks dalam mode 0.

Langkah 3: Opsi 3 - Selamat datang di abad ke-21

Opsi 3 - Selamat datang di abad ke-21
Opsi 3 - Selamat datang di abad ke-21

Cabut joystick itu dan lihat ini;

www.instructables.com/id/Atari-8-Bit-Optic…

Menikmati

Direkomendasikan: